Understanding the Core Mechanics of Crash Games

Before delving into the specifics of aviator predictor tools, it's vital to understand the underlying mechanics that govern these “crash” games. Most operate on a provably fair system, often utilizing a random number generator (RNG) to determine the crash multiplier. This means that the outcome isn’t predetermined by the game operator; instead, it’s generated transparently, allowing players to verify its fairness. However, even with a provably fair system, randomness inherently makes predicting the exact crash point impossible. The multiplier isn't linear; it starts slow, accelerates as the ‘flight’ continues, and then eventually plateaus before the crash. This dynamic curve is a key factor in developing any winning strategy. Understanding the statistical distribution of multipliers is crucial for evaluating the effectiveness of any predictive model.

The Role of Random Number Generators (RNGs)

The RNG is the heart of these games, ensuring fairness and unpredictability. It isn't a simple number generator; instead, sophisticated algorithms produce sequences of numbers appearing random. Reputable game providers utilize certified RNGs, which are regularly audited by independent third parties to confirm their integrity. Players can typically access information about the RNG seed used for a particular round, allowing them to independently verify the outcome's fairness. While you can't predict the output of a true RNG, understanding its principles is important. A biased or flawed RNG undermines the entire system, making it susceptible to manipulation. Therefore, choosing platforms using certified and regularly audited RNGs is paramount for a secure gaming experience.

Statistical Analysis vs. Machine Learning

Statistical analysis typically involves calculating basic metrics like average multipliers, standard deviation, and frequency of crash points. This provides a general overview of past performance but doesn’t account for the dynamic nature of the game. Machine learning, on the other hand, utilizes algorithms that can learn from data and improve their predictive accuracy over time. These algorithms can identify complex patterns that might be missed by traditional statistical methods. However, machine learning models require large datasets and careful parameter tuning to avoid overfitting – where the model performs well on historical data but poorly on new data. The efficacy of machine learning-based predictors still relies on the assumption that patterns exist within the randomness, which is a contentious debate in the gaming community.

Evaluating the Effectiveness of an Aviator Predictor

If you choose to employ an aviator predictor, it's crucial to evaluate its effectiveness rigorously. Don't simply rely on claims of high accuracy; test the tool thoroughly using historical data and a demo account (if available). Track the predictor’s performance over a significant number of rounds and compare its results to a simple random strategy. Consider metrics like win rate, average profit per trade, and maximum drawdown. A true test involves using the predictor with real money, but start with very small stakes to minimize risk. Be skeptical of any tool that promises guaranteed profits or requires a substantial upfront investment. Remember that no predictor is perfect, and the ultimate responsibility for managing risk lies with the player.
